Keep your hands clean

Posted

Proper handwashing is important to staying healthy.
It is especially critical during the covid-19 pandemic.
You should be washing your hands with soap and water for at least 20 seconds.
Hand sanitizer is good for when you’re on the go.
It may be difficult to find right now. Stores are sold out and are trying to restock.
Please be patient in your community, and share if you have extra.
In the meantime, you can make your own hand sanitizer.
You will need:
• 99% rubbing alcohol
• Aloe vera gel
• Essential oil such as lavender or tea tree. You can even use lemon juice.
Pour all ingredients into a bowl, mix with a spoon and then beat with a whisk to form into gel. Pour the ingredients into an empty bottle and label “hand sanitizer.”
If you can make extra, give it to your neighbors and coworkers.
We can all come together as a community to help each other.
